Leadership Lessons from The Last Emperor

In this episode, Tom Fox and Richard Lummis look at leadership lessons from the Best-Picture winning film, The Last Emperor.

Episode 36 of the Popcorn and Compliance podcast, hosted by Thomas Fox, titled "Leadership Lessons from The Last Emperor" was published on September 3, 2022 and runs 15 minutes.

We continue our look at Oscar-winning Best Pictures and consider the leadership lessons we can glean from our viewing. In this episode, Richard Lummis and I take at the 1987 Best Picture winning film, The Last Emperor. Some of the highlights were: This was the first movie shot in the Forbidden City; How does one lead in an era or region of different values and different cultures? Are the trappings of your power as a business leader only that, mere trappings? If so what does this mean?
